Debenhams
The brand Debenhams was among the most well-known brands on the Great British high street. It was established in 1818, and the first store it opened was outside of London. The company grew rapidly and even bought Knightsbridge retailer Harvey Nichols in 1928.
Belinda Earl, as chief executive of the company, pushed the company to re-expande in the early 2000s. Earl launched the cult Designers at Debenhams label, featuring top fashion designers offering items at Debenhams' prices. She also took the first step towards international growth by opening stores in Bahrain, Kuwait and other countries.
The company was in trouble. By 2022 all Debenhams stores had closed and the company was purchased by the online competitor Boohoo. The sale has left behind vacant retail units in town centres, which are difficult to reuse. Fortunately, some have been converted into residential or co-working spaces. A lot of these spaces are empty. This is due in part to the change in the retail market, as less Britons shop in-store. Those who shop online spend more on clothes and gadgets for the home.
